2018 NLCS: Dodger Stadium Parking, Public Transportation & Gates Info, First Pitch, Start Times For Games 3 And 4 Vs. Brewers

After dropping the opener of the National League Championship Series, the Los Angeles Dodgers guaranteed Dodger Stadium would host at least three more postseason games this year by earning a split with the Milwaukee Brewers at Miller Park.

Game 3 is set for Monday, with first pitch at Dodger Stadium coming at 4:39 p.m. PT. Parking and stadium gates will open at 1:40 p.m. PT, which will allow fans to take in all the pregame festivities.

The Dodgers will take batting practice at 1:50 p.m., followed by the Brewers at 2:40 p.m. Player introductions and pregame ceremonies begin at 4 p.m. Andre Ethier is throwing out the ceremonial first pitch before Game 3, and Keith Williams Jr. will sing the national anthem.

For Game 4 on Tuesday, a 6:09 p.m. start, Dodger Stadium parking and entry gates open at 3:10 p.m. Pregame programming begins at 5:50 p.m., which will include Shawn Green throwing out the first pitch and Pia Toscano signing the national anthem.

Fans are encouraged to arrive early, purchase parking in advance, carpool or utilize a rideshare service. Additionally, the Dodger Stadium Express continues to operate during the postseason from both Union Station and the South Bay.

Service starts two hours before first pitch and is free for everyone with a game ticket. Advance parking can be purchased at Dodgers.com/parking and more information on transportation options can be found at Dodgers.com/transportation.

The NLCS is being broadcast FOX Sports 1, and all Dodgers postseason games can be heard on AM 570 L.A. Sports Radio and in Spanish on Univision 1020 KTNQ. Aditionally, SportsNet LA has coverage prior and after each postseason game.

Dodgers vs. Brewers NLCS schedule & TV info

Game 1: Brewers 6, Dodgers 5
Game 2: Dodgers 4, Brewers 3
Game 3: Monday, Oct. 15, 4:39 p.m., Dodger Stadium (FS1)
Game 4: Tuesday, Oct. 16, 6:09 p.m., Dodger Stadium (FS1)
Game 5: Wednesday, Oct. 17, 2:05 p.m., Dodger Stadium (FS1)
Game 6*: Friday, Oct. 19, 5:39 p.m., Miller Park (FS1)
Game 7*: Saturday, Oct. 20, 6:09 p.m., Miller Park (FS1)

*if necessary
